On June 13, 2013, OSHA issued this direct final rule to update general industry and construction signage standards by adding references to the latest versions of ANSI standards on specifications for accident prevention signs and tags. The direct final rule allows employers to follow either the updated ANSI standards or the older ANSI signage standards already referenced in OSHA’s existing general industry and construction standards. The direct final rule also incorporates by reference Part VI of the Manual of Uniform Traffic Control Devices, 1988 Edition, Revision 3, into 29 CFR 1926.6, and amends citations in two provisions of the construction standards to show the correct incorporation by reference section.
On November 6, 2013, OSHA issued a correction to the direct final rule as well as a confirmation of effective date [Federal Register (Vol. 78, No. 114) and Federal Register (Vol. 78, No. 215)].
The N.C. Commissioner of Labor adopted this direct final rule, confirmation of effective date and correction verbatim with an effective date of November 18, 2013.
